Redwire Corporation (NYSE: RDW) delivered better-than-expected sales results for the second quarter of 2026, sending its shares higher as investors responded to stronger operational momentum. The performance reflects continued expansion in the commercial space sector, where demand for satellite systems, space infrastructure, and defense-related technologies is increasing.
Strong Revenue Growth Highlights Expanding Space Technology Demand
Redwire’s latest quarterly performance exceeded Wall Street expectations, with sales growth demonstrating continued demand for the company’s space technology products and services. The company operates across multiple segments of the space industry, providing solutions including satellite components, spacecraft systems, and advanced manufacturing technologies designed for commercial and government customers.
The stronger-than-anticipated results underline the broader expansion of the global space economy, where governments, defense organizations, and private companies are increasing investment in satellite communications, space-based infrastructure, and next-generation aerospace capabilities.
Redwire has positioned itself as a supplier within this evolving market by focusing on technologies that support both established space programs and emerging commercial opportunities. The company’s ability to secure contracts and expand its customer base remains a key factor influencing future revenue growth.
Investor Reaction Reflects Expectations for Future Space Industry Growth
The positive market response following Redwire’s earnings report reflects investor interest in companies positioned to benefit from long-term trends in aerospace and defense technology. Space-related industries have attracted increased attention as satellite deployment, national security requirements, and commercial space activities continue expanding.
However, investors remain focused on whether revenue growth can translate into sustainable profitability. Space technology companies often face challenges related to high research and development costs, lengthy contract cycles, supply-chain complexity, and the need for continued investment in innovation.
Redwire’s future performance will depend not only on sales expansion but also on operational efficiency, cost management, and its ability to execute large-scale projects successfully.
